Get in TouchThe BMW repair market for Shell Knob residents is entirely dependent on providers in Springfield, MO. The **average quality** of specialized service in Springfield is high, with several shops capable of performing to German manufacturer standards. The **competition level** among these specialists is moderate, which helps maintain reasonable pricing and a focus on customer service. **Typical Pricing** is in line with independent specialist shops nationwide, generally ranging from **$120 - $165 per hour for labor**. This is significantly lower than dealership rates but higher than a general mechanic, reflecting the required expertise, proprietary tools, and advanced diagnostic software. Parts costs can be high for genuine BMW components, but these shops often offer high-quality OEM or aftermarket alternatives to provide cost-effective solutions. For Shell Knob owners, the primary consideration is the drive to Springfield, which is a necessary trade-off for receiving expert, brand-specific care.

Shell Knob is a small lakeside community, so there are no dedicated BMW dealerships or specialists within the town itself. For complex repairs, owners typically travel to specialists in Springfield or Branson. However, some local general repair shops may have experience with common BMW maintenance.
Given the hilly, winding roads around Table Rock Lake, suspension components like control arms and struts often wear out. The local climate also contributes to issues; summer heat can stress cooling systems, while winter moisture can lead to electrical gremlins and corrosion.
Ask specifically about their training, diagnostic tooling (like BMW-specific scanners), and experience with your model's common issues. In a smaller market like Shell Knob, checking online reviews and asking for references from other European car owners is crucial to find a qualified technician.
Labor rates at independent shops in Shell Knob are generally lower than at a dealership, but parts costs for genuine BMW components remain high. The potential savings come from the labor rate and the ability to sometimes use high-quality aftermarket parts, but you must confirm the shop has proper part sourcing.
Be proactive about inspecting suspension and steering after navigating rough or gravel access roads. Also, pay close attention to cooling system warnings in summer and address any minor electrical issues immediately, as humidity from the lake can accelerate problems.
